A dead child and his seriously injured father are found in an apartment in Bremen. The autopsy brings clarity – and the father is investigated.

After the death of a seven-year-old boy in an apartment in The body was autopsied in Bremen. “The autopsy confirms that the boy was the victim of a violent crime,” said a spokesman for the public prosecutor’s office.

A natural death could be ruled out; he did not provide any more precise information about the cause of death. The father is strongly suspected of having first killed the boy and then inflicted injuries on himself. A decision will be made later today as to whether the 46-year-old will be remanded in custody.

According to the public prosecutor’s office, the boy was visiting his father at the weekend. The 46-year-old is said to have called his sister and announced the crime on the phone. At the time of the crime, the man and his son were alone in the apartment.

Homicide squad investigates

The police found the seriously injured man and the lifeless child in the apartment in the old town on Sunday night. The boy died despite immediate resuscitation efforts. The injured father was taken to a hospital and underwent surgery there on Sunday. The spokesman for the public prosecutor’s office was initially unable to provide any information about the suspect’s current state of health.

The man is being investigated for homicide. The background to the crime is now the subject of the murder squad’s investigation. The spokesman for the public prosecutor’s office initially did not provide any information about the 46-year-old’s nationality because it had nothing to do with the crime.
